The surname Carael has its roots in various languages and cultures, leading to different interpretations and meanings. One of the possible origins of the name is from the Philippines, where it is a relatively common surname. In fact, according to data, the incidence of the Carael surname in the Philippines is quite high, with 774 individuals bearing this surname. The name could have originated from a local language or dialect, with a specific meaning or connotation that may be lost to history.
Another possible origin of the Carael surname is from Belgium, where it is also found, although with a lower incidence compared to the Philippines. In Belgium, there are 102 individuals with the surname Carael, suggesting a smaller but still significant presence of the name in the country. The Belgian origin of the surname may have a different meaning or etymology compared to its Filipino counterpart, reflecting the diverse linguistic and cultural influences in the region.
Furthermore, the Carael surname is also found in France, albeit with a much lower incidence compared to the Philippines and Belgium. With only 1 individual bearing the name in France, the presence of the surname is relatively minor in the country.
